I&FC issues flood advisory as IMD forecasts heavy rain in South Kashmir
Srinagar, July 21 -- The Irrigation and Flood Control (I&FC) Department has issued a flood advisory after the India Meteorological Department (IMD) forecast a spell of intense rainfall over the Jhelum Basin, warning of the possibility of flash floods and a rapid rise in water levels.
According to an advisory issued by the Office of the Chief Engineer, I&FC Kashmir, the IMD has forecast a "significantly strong spell of rainfall" over the Jhelum Basin during the morning of July 21.
The advisory said South Kashmir, particularly the districts of Anantnag, Kulgam and Shopian, is likely to receive 50-100 mm of rainfall. Another spell of lower-intensity rainfall is expected during the morning of July 22.
